Ordinals
beta
Sat 634991785689710
decimal
21383.12985689710
percentile
1.26998357137942%
name
mkqyubytezqh
cycle
0
epoch
2
block
21383
offset
12985689710
timestamp
2023-12-24 07:44:23 UTC
rarity
common
prev
next